Hydraulic oil pipes can be categorized based on their materials. The two main types are high – pressure steel wire braided hydraulic oil pipes and cloth – covered rubber hydraulic oil pipes. Among these, steel wire braided hoses are the most widely favored. Boasting high strength and remarkable toughness, they are capable of withstanding significant pressure and impact loads. In essence, they are perfectly suited for applications involving high temperatures and high pressures.

Diverse Types of Hydraulic Oil Hoses

Hydraulic oil pipes can also be classified according to their pressure ratings into low – pressure and high – pressure hydraulic oil pipes. Low – pressure hydraulic oil pipes typically operate at working pressures below 16MPa. They are well – adapted for low – pressure hydraulic systems, such as those found in ships and agricultural machinery. In contrast, high – pressure hydraulic oil pipes function at pressures above 16MPa and are predominantly utilized in high – pressure hydraulic systems, including those of machine tools and construction machinery.

Design Considerations for Hydraulic Oil Pipes

The design of hydraulic oil pipes is a complex process that requires careful consideration of numerous factors. These include working pressure, fluid flow rate, temperature, vibration, and the potential for corrosion. Among the most crucial parameters in the design process are the diameter and wall thickness of the hydraulic oil pipes. These dimensions must be determined based on the working pressure and flow rate requirements. Generally, as the diameter of the hydraulic oil pipe decreases, its ability to withstand higher working pressures increases. The wall thickness, on the other hand, is determined by the strength and toughness of the pipe material. It is essential to ensure that the pipe can resist deformation and breakage under the applied working pressure.
